The market place

La piazza del mercato

La seconda piazza più importante di Brno è Zelny ter, più conosciuta come piazza del mercato, dominata dall’imponente torre dell’ex municipio, risalente al XV secolo, alla quale si accede attraversando un pregevole portico gotico. Al centro della piazza si trova la fontana di Ercole, in stile barocco, che mostra l’eroe greco in lotta con alcuni mostri e due teatri, tra cui il Teatro Nazionale di Brno, dove suonò Mozart da bambino. Non distante si può raggiungere il Convento dei Cappuccini dove nella cripta si possono vedere i corpi mummificati dei frati, che anziché essere sepolti venivano semplicemente appoggiati sul terreno e, grazie all’aria particolarmente secca, si mummificavano.
